Graduate of Southeastern Bible College and Samford University, Carl served as a bi-vocational minister of music for numerous churches in the Birmingham, Alabama area for 35 years. He also taught Bible classes for over 30 years. He was a current member of Lakeside Baptist Church and a former member of Green Valley Baptist Church.

Carl retired from the Xerox Corporation as an engineering specialist. He and his wife Joan enjoyed traveling, and he was a veracious reader and a tenacious chess player.

Carl was preceded in death by his parents, Carl Warmath Chambers Sr. (1896-1965) and Lila Mae Nelson Chambers, and his sister, Margaret Hardison (1928-1974); Find A Grave Memorial# 190811724.
Paternal Grandparents: Robert Thomas Chambers (1843-1921) and Mary Ella Warmoth Chambers (1868-1952) of Gibson County, Tennessee.
Maternal Grandparents: William S. Nelson (1873-1930) and Cora Ayer Nelson (1873-1952) of Georgia.

Survivors include Carl's wife of 63 years, Dr. Joan Gardiner Chambers; two children, Rita Schoenherr (Rick) and Dale Chambers (Cathy); and two granddaughters, Lauren and Alyssa Chambers.

Burial will be at Elmwood Cemetery.
